The Calcutta Symphony Orchestra is an orchestra that once existed in Calcutta, India. The last conductor of the orchestra was Bunny Jacob.[1][2][3]
Francisco Casanovas also once conducted the orchestra and Yehudi Menuhin performed with it in 1952.
